Excerpt from Todd's Catalogue of Fruit-Ful Strawberry Plants, 1928 Parcell. (imp.) Fruited here last season and did not please me. It produced plenty of berries of various size and shape, rough and of poor quality. -i am h0ping that it makes a better showing this season. It makes fine plant -beds, of large, healthy, deepi rooted plants and I have a nice lot of them if you wish to give it a' trial. I It originated in New York and is described by the introducers as the most vigorous and healthiest growing plant that -we have ever seen. Fruits very late and is more productive than any other latei varieties. The berries are large, dark red, extra high quality. Eighteen selected berries filled a quart box. Excerpt from Catalog of Strawberries and Other Small Fruit Plants, 1923 We have grown them for the past ten years, during which time they have never frozen back, or failed to produce a large crop of berries. The berries, which are a beautiful jet black, ripen in large quantities, without red seeds, green tips, or the hard pits in the center found in inferior ber ries. They respond well to careful culture and repay the grower many times for his care and attention. Each plant in our fine lot of root-cutting black berry plants has a well-developed root system of its own. You are certain to get a liberal picking from them the first season after planting. The culture of blackberries is a very simple matter. It is important that they be placed in the ground, at just the depth at which they were grown, pref erably in light soil. Trim to a height of two or three feet the following season. It is well to pick out the centers of the plants while they are grow ing to increase the number of branches. The root-cutting blackberry will cost a little more than the ordinary blackberry, but will more than repay you for the added expense.
